RECORDING SECRETARY
Standard Duties
-
Maintain records and notes for the benefit of next year's office
holder.
-
Attend and participate in all Committee meetings.
-
Understand that a Committee member may only incur one (1)
unexcused, and two (2) excused absences and that a substitute
may be sent without voting rights unless vote is in writing and
the Chair is informed beforehand.
-
The chairperson's purpose is to manage the Spring Fling
conference to its fullest capacity and bring ideas, solutions
and choices to the Committee for approval or denial. The Spring
Fling Committee Chairperson will provide general leadership. It
is the primary responsibility of each officer to provide
specific leadership in their specific areas to initiate action
to its successful conclusion.
Officer Duties
-
Record and take minutes at all meetings.
-
Transcribe minutes and provide a copy to all committee members.
The original is filed in the archive binder.
-
Provide copies of minutes to members several days before the
next scheduled meeting.
-
A current committee member list should be distributed to all
members. This list includes position title, name, address, and
e-mail, home and work numbers. The list is to be updated and
distributed as changes occur within the committee.
-
Submit periodic invoice to Treasurer for reimbursement for
stamps and/or supplies used to provide monthly minutes.
-
A mini recorder is available for the Recording Secretary's use.
